Understanding Medical Microneedling MMP
Medical microneedling MMP stands for “Micro-Medical Puncture.” It is an advanced technique that uses fine, sterile needles to create controlled micro-injuries in the skin. This procedure is similar to the microneedling skin treatment used to treat different cosmetic conditions.
The process will trigger the body’s natural healing response, which stimulates the production of collagen and elastin. The two proteins are essential for maintaining firm, smooth, and youthful skin.
Unlike cosmetic microneedling rollers or devices used in home care routines, MMP is a professional, medical-grade procedure. This means it is performed under the supervision of licensed clinicians. The treatment works beneath the skin’s surface, where true regeneration happens.
Each microchannel created during medical microneedling MMP Treatment acts as a pathway for active ingredients or therapeutic solutions to penetrate deeper into the skin. This allows for better absorption and enhanced results.
The procedure is a minimally invasive treatment. This means there’s very little downtime, and patients typically see gradual improvements in their skin texture, tone, and elasticity.
The Science Behind MMP and Collagen Induction
The foundation of MMP treatment benefits lies in its ability to encourage the body’s own repair mechanisms. When micro-injuries occur, the skin responds by producing new collagen and elastin fibers. These compounds serve as the building blocks of a healthy, resilient skin.
As new collagen forms, it fills in fine lines, smooths wrinkles, and restores firmness. Elastin helps the skin maintain its structure. It also gives that supple, bouncy quality associated with youth. Over time, this combination results in smoother, firmer, and more radiant skin.
The science behind microneedling is well-established and supported by dermatological research. Studies show that consistent treatments can lead to a significant increase in collagen production, improving both the skin’s appearance and its overall health.
The procedure also promotes better blood circulation. As such, it helps deliver oxygen and nutrients to the skin cells, further enhancing the rejuvenation process.

The Experience: What to Expect During Medical Microneedling MMP
When patients come in for Medical Microneedling MMP Treatment in Boca Raton, FL , the procedure typically begins with a thorough skin assessment. A numbing cream may also be applied to ensure comfort throughout the procedure.
Once the skin is prepared, a sterile microneedling device is used to create precise micro-injuries in the targeted area.
During the treatment, specialized serums or medications may be applied to enhance results. These formulations penetrate deeper through the microchannels created by the needles. Thus, they address specific concerns such as pigmentation, scarring, or loss of elasticity.
After the procedure, mild redness or sensitivity is common, similar to a light sunburn. These effects are normal and will subside within a day or two. Patients often describe their skin as feeling tighter and more refreshed soon after treatment.
Over the following weeks, as collagen production increases, patients can expect to notice other improvements to begin to emerge: smoother texture, reduced lines, and a luminous glow.
